
Italian Bean Patties
Combine your favorite beans with herbs and spices to make a delicious patty for dinner tonight!

Ingredients
low-sodium canned beans, canned
2 cups · or cooked from dry
egg
1 · beaten
gar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on
onion powder
1/2 teaspoon
Italian seasoning
2 teaspoons
bread crumbs
1 cup · dry, or cracker crumbs
cornmeal
1/8 cup · or all purpose flour
vegetable oil
2 tablespoons · or cooking oil of your choice
Instructions
- 1
Wash hands with soap and water.
- 2
In a large bowl, mash beans. Add egg and spices and stir to mix evenly.
- 3
Stir in bread crumbs. If mixture seems too wet add more breadcrumbs, 1 tablespoon at a time until mixture resembles meatloaf.
- 4
Shape into little sausages or patties. Roll in cornmeal or flour.
- 5
Fry slowly in vegetable oil over medium heat until crusty and golden brown.
Notes
- •Serve in place of hamburgers and add toppings.
- •Serve in place of breakfast sausage.
